Leon Cooperman (Trades, Portfolio), founder of hedge fund Omega Advisors Inc., reported owning 12 million shares of Aspen Group Inc. (OTCBB:ASPU, Financial), equal to 9.9% of the shares outstanding, as of April 23.

Aspen, an online post-secondary education company, saw its share price increase 46.3% over the past year to $0.22 per share.

In its fiscal third quarter the company announced a 28% increase in revenue from the previous year to $1.29 million. Its net loss was $1.24 million compared to $1.73 million.

The company highlighted in its results that its nursing program enrollment grew 57% year over year during the quarter to make up 38% of its total student body.

Aspen Group has a P/B ratio of 20, near a one-year high, and a market cap of $23.2 million.
